What the best option for fluid?
-
I use dex6 works good for me. But like motor oil there many opinions on what is "best"
-
I use type f on the stock trannys. Read that it doesn't foam up like the dexron. No issues with it and after a few filter changes it will be mostly all type F. Think I read that on the spring cleaning list at gnttype website.
After having a high end built up tranny done, that guy recommended John Deere low viscosity hy-guard and one quart of something red so you can read the dipstick. That tranny has been beat on pretty hard with no issues.
